Google Colaboratory (also known as Colab) is a free Jupyter Notebook hosted environment from Google. It allows one to run a notebook wholly in the cloud and store the code and data in Google Drive.
Quarto is an open-source scientific and technical publishing system based on Markdown that allows users to write in plain-text Markdown or work with Jupyter notebooks and embed executable code in Python, R, Julia, or Observable JS.
It supports Pandoc-style Markdown with equations, citations, cross-references, figure panels, and advanced layout, and renders a single source into formats such as HTML, PDF, MS Word, ePub, presentations, websites, blogs, or books.
